Hi. My name is William Kai. I received my Scout Ranger Award from Kennesaw Mountain National Battlefield Park located in Georgia. When I was a Cub Scout, I participated in eight Junior Ranger programs in two camps to achieve my award. I earned my first Junior Ranger badge from Martin Luther King, Jr. National Historical Park. I like learning about our country's history by visiting the park's museum, seeing where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. lived, and doing the activities and the Junior Ranger program.
After visiting, I decided to participate in more Junior Ranger programs and camps to learn more about our country's history and nature. It was a lot of fun to interact with what I was knowing about that park. I think other Cub Scouts and Scouts should do it too because you can learn and see really interesting things.
You can learn about the history of our country's Indigenous people and our national history. You can see amazing things in nature that you won't see anywhere else, the Old Faithful geyser, or the sequoias, and the animals that live there. It's important to be part of national parks because they preserve our history, natural environment, and our animals. Scout Ranger Award is a very fun way for Scouts to be a part of national parks.
